Artikel Jurnal
Impact of Automated Software Testing Tools on Reflective Thinking and Student Performance in Introductory Computer Science Programming Classes (e-journal)
Learning to write good computer code is a difficult task for introductory programming students. Students can learn what constitutes good programming practice, but actually writing a program requires a different kind of experience. Hence, programming assignments are an integral part of the learning experience in introductory programming courses. Instructors assign programming tasks to students as solo work with strict warnings against collaboration. A student in an introductory programming class may excel at theoretical assignments like tests and quizzes and yet struggle through programming assignments.
Tidak tersedia versi lain